home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Libris Britannia 4
/
science library(b).zip
/
science library(b)
/
PROGRAMM
/
PASCAL
/
1463.ZIP
/
DRAW-2D.ARC
/
VAR.PAS
< prev
next >
Wrap
Pascal/Delphi Source File
|
1986-12-04
|
890b
|
27 lines
VAR
X,Y,SCALX,SCALY,LASTX,LASTY:REAL;
OBJ:ARRAY[1..8] OF STRING[8];
MODE:ARRAY[1..3] OF STRING[4];
SELNUM,BELLCODE,HRCOLOR,NPOLY:INTEGER;
XWORLD:REAL;
T:CHAR;
TP:STR4;
BLKLINE:SCRLINE;
STOP,CLIN,STARTOBJ,BUTTON1,BUTTON2,CURFLAG,QUIT:BOOLEAN;
DRAWREC:OBJECT;
DRAWARY:ARRAY [1..MAXSIZE] OF OBJECT;
DRAWFIL:FILE OF OBJECT;
DFILE:FSTR;
OBJPTR,OTYP,LEV,CODE:INTEGER;
REGS:REGIS;
PIXX,PIXY,XPMIN,XPMAX,XPIX,YPMIN,YPMAX,YPIX,XPREV,YPREV:INTEGER;
XDMIN,XDMAX,YDMIN,YDMAX:REAL;
XVMIN,XVMAX,YVMIN,YVMAX:REAL;
XWMIN,XWMAX,YWMIN,YWMAX:REAL;
VEC:VECTOR;
IDMAT,CLRMAT,ROTMAT,SCALEMAT,TRANSMAT,WORLDMAT,TEMPMAT:MATRIX;
STKMAT: ARRAY[1..10] OF MATRIX;
STKPTR:INTEGER;
CUR:ARRAY[0..31] OF INTEGER;
M1,M2,M3,M4:INTEGER;
MNUM,OPTION,LASTPOS:INTEGER;